On 08/27/16 22:41, Cameron Shorter wrote:
I like the GeoNode process for signing Contributor License Agreements,
and suggest that we should introduce something similar for OSGeo-Live

clahub.com <http://clahub.com>

I'd argue for dropping a CLA, it only raises the barrier to contribute without much benefit for the project.

See also: http://ebb.org/bkuhn/blog/2014/06/09/do-not-need-cla.html

I've recently retracted my pull requests to the protobuf project because they require a CLA before considering the contributions. If you require me to sign a legal document before accepting my patches, I choose not to contribute to your project. The effort is simply not worth it.
